FY2017 H1B Overview for Aberdeen Asset Management, Inc.

In fiscal year 2017, Aberdeen Asset Management, Inc. filed 4 H1B labor condition applications with the U.S. Department of Labor. Of these, 0 were certified and 0 were denied. The average salary offered on these applications was $103,507.

The applications covered a total of 4 worker positions, as a single LCA can cover multiple workers in the same role and location.

Aberdeen Asset Management, Inc. also filed 1 PERM (green card) applications in FY2017, with 1 certified, indicating ongoing commitment to long-term sponsorship for foreign workers.

FY2017 H1B Filings by Aberdeen Asset Management, Inc.

Individual labor condition applications filed by Aberdeen Asset Management, Inc. in fiscal year 2017. There are 4 filings total.

Case #StatusJob TitleSalaryLocationDate
I-200-17192-645617 Certified GROUP HEAD OF SPONSORSHIP AND CORPORATE EVENTS $193,610 PHILADELPHIA, PA 2017-07-18
I-200-17067-862317 Certified GRADUATE BUSINESS ANALYST $57,500 PHILADELPHIA, PA 2017-03-24
I-200-17069-470469 Certified CORPORATE STRATEGY MANAGER $90,000 PHILADELPHIA, PA 2017-03-24
I-200-17075-916188 Certified INVESTMENT CONTROL OFFICER $72,917 PHILADELPHIA, PA 2017-03-24
